The durability and extended life expectancy associated with an LED Lighting Installation use a level of dependability that far goes beyond the vulnerable nature of older, vacuum-sealed glass filaments. High-quality light-emitting diodes are solid-state components, making them extremely resilient versus physical vibrations and external impacts, with numerous units ranked to last for tens of thousands of operational hours. This makes LED Lighting Installation an ideal solution for challenging areas such as high-vaulted ceilings, external security borders, or stairwells where routine maintenance is both hard and dangerous. Within a busy business environment in Australia, the dramatically lowered frequency of maintenance cycles suggests that center managers can reroute resources away from consistent globe replacements toward more productive tasks. In addition, the instant-on ability of a modern-day LED Lighting Installation ensures that there is no frustrating warm-up period, supplying optimum brightness the minute the switch is engaged, which is vital for both safety and operational performance.
Technical security and regulative compliance are important pillars of any electrical task, and the procedure of LED Lighting Installation is no exception to these rigid requirements. While some might see this as an easy job, an extensive LED Lighting Installation includes browsing complex circuitry, ensuring driver compatibility, and mitigating fire risks associated with improper clearance from ceiling insulation. Licensed electrical contractors ensure that every fixture integrated during an LED Lighting Installation is fitted with appropriate thermal security and that existing dimmer switches work with the new technology to avoid flickering or audible buzzing. Additionally, an expertly executed LED Lighting Installation assurances that the home stays in rigorous adherence to the latest building codes and security standards of NSW. By engaging a certified professional, residents can rest assured that their new illumination system is not just visually pleasing but likewise electrically sound, safeguarding the home from potential faults or second-rate components.
